What are the electrical requirements?
The T32459 operates on 110V, single-phase, 60 Hz power. Full-load current is 7.8A, and a 15A circuit is recommended. A 72-inch, 16 AWG power cord with a 5-15 plug is included.
Is the motor AC or DC?
The sander/grinder has a brushless DC motor with an internal circuit board to control speed.
What is the motor size and speed range?
The machine uses a 3/4 HP motor with a variable speed range of 100–3200 RPM.
Is the motor reversible?
No. The motor on the T32459 is not reversible.
Can the T32459 be upgraded to a T32459Z?
Yes. You must purchase both PT32459Z014 Motor and PT32459Z017 Control Box. They must be replaced together; a T32459 controller will not run a T32459Z motor and vice versa.
What type of sanding belt does the T32459 use?
The machine uses a 2" x 42" belt. A 120-grit silicon carbide belt is included.
Can I use a different size belt?
The machine is designed for 2" x 42" belts. Using a 48" belt is not recommended; the adjustment arm would extend near its limit, and performance is uncertain. Smaller belts (like 1") are not supported.

Can the wheel in the back be used for hollow grinds?
No. Using the back roller for hollow grinding is not recommended because debris may be directed toward the operator.
What type of cutterhead or platen does it have?
Graphite-coated platen: 5-1/2" x 2-1/4"
Platen tilts 30° left/right on frame
Tool rest adjusts for vertical and horizontal grinding
Can I remove the pulley wheel guards or use the wheels as a sanding surface?
No. The guards are necessary for safety. Removing them may cause the belt to lose traction and create hazards.
What are the wheel sizes and construction?
Drive wheel: 5" diameter x 2" wide
Idler wheel: 1-1/2" diameter x 2" wide
Wheels have ball bearings and a slight crown
What is the base size?
The steel base measures 14" x 9.5".
Can this machine be mounted on the ceiling or run upside down?
No. The machine is not designed to operate inverted.
Can I use water misting for cooling?
No. Electrical components are not enclosed. Dipping workpieces is recommended instead.
Is there a duty cycle?
No designated duty cycle is provided.
What is the noise level?
The machine does not have a specific sound rating. Noise varies depending on material and belt grit.

Can the T32459 take 2x48 belts?
No. It is designed exclusively for 2" x 42" belts.
Are there stands available?
Yes. Optional stands, such as T33204 with a 300 lb capacity, are compatible.
What is the assembly and setup time?
The machine is mostly assembled. Setup takes approximately 15 minutes.
